Basic information
| Entry | Database: PDB / ID: 8hwo | ||||||
|---|---|---|---|---|---|---|---|
| Title | Crystal Structure of mutant GDSL Esterase of Photobacterium sp. J15 | ||||||
Components | GDSL-family esterase | ||||||
Keywords | HYDROLASE / GDSL esterase | ||||||
| Function / homology | GDSL lipase/esterase / GDSL-like Lipase/Acylhydrolase / SGNH hydrolase superfamily / hydrolase activity, acting on ester bonds / GDSL-family esterase Function and homology information | ||||||
| Biological species | Photobacterium sp. J15 (bacteria) | ||||||
| Method | X-RAY DIFFRACTION / MOLECULAR REPLACEMENT / Resolution: 1.96 Å | ||||||
Authors | Rahman, N.N.A. / Leow, T.C. / Jonet, M.A. | ||||||
| Funding support | 1items
| ||||||
Citation | Journal: 3 Biotech / Year: 2023Title: X-ray crystallography of mutant GDSL esterase S12A of Photobacterium marinum J15. Authors: Rahman, N.N.A. / Sharif, F.M. / Kamarudin, N.H.A. / Ali, M.S.M. / Aris, S.N.A.M. / Jonet, M.A. / Rahman, R.N.Z.R.A. / Sabri, S. / Leow, T.C. #1: Journal: Int J Biol Macromol / Year: 2018Title: Crystallization and structure elucidation of GDSL esterase of Photobacterium sp. J15 Authors: Mazlan, S.N.H.S. / Ali, M.S.M. / Rahman, N.N.A. / Sabri, S. / Jonet, M.A. / Leow, T.C. | ||||||

Components
| #1: Protein | Mass: 35643.965 Da / Num. of mol.: 1 / Mutation: S12A Source method: isolated from a genetically manipulated source Source: (gene. exp.) Photobacterium sp. J15 (bacteria) / Production host: ![]() |
|---|
-Experimental details
-Experiment
| Experiment | Method: X-RAY DIFFRACTION / Number of used crystals: 1 |
|---|
-
Sample preparation
| Crystal | Density Matthews: 2.59 Å3/Da / Density % sol: 52.55 % |
|---|---|
| Crystal grow | Temperature: 293.15 K / Method: vapor diffusion, sitting drop Details: 0.2 M ammonium acetate as salt, 30% (w/v) polyethylene glycol 4,000 as precipitant in 0.1 M sodium acetate trihydrate buffer at pH 4.6 |
-Data collection
|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
|---|---|
| Diffraction source | Source: ROTATING ANODE / Type: RIGAKU / Wavelength: 1.5418 Å |
| Detector | Type: RIGAKU / Detector: CCD / Date: Oct 2, 2019 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 1.5418 Å / Relative weight: 1 |
| Reflection | Resolution: 1.96→40 Å / Num. obs: 25427 / % possible obs: 98.6 % / Redundancy: 1.8 % / CC1/2: 1 / Net I/σ(I): 13.4 |
| Reflection shell | Resolution: 1.96→1.96 Å / Redundancy: 1.8 % / Mean I/σ(I) obs: 2.1 / Num. unique obs: 25427 / CC1/2: 1 / % possible all: 98.38 |
